Easy Vegan Garlic Breadsticks

April 24, 2019 by Angela Louise 3 Comments
Easy Vegan Garlic Breadsticks

I’m the person who can eat a whole basket of breadsticks before they bring my food out and, these easy vegan garlic breadsticks are no exception. Soft, buttery, warm, and easy to make. These breadsticks go great with pasta, soup, or with a side of marinara sauce. It’ll take roughly an hour from start to finish to bake a batch of these breadsticks and even less time to eat them all. Since the dough is very simple, play around with the seasoning and try adding different herbs and non-dairy cheese. So next time you have pasta, soup, or a craving for breadsticks give this recipe a try.

Vegan Katsu Curry With Baked Tofu

April 3, 2019 by Angela Louise 6 Comments
Vegan Katsu Curry With Baked Tofu

So one thing I don’t enjoy doing when cooking is frying. I always seem to make a mess and get oil everywhere or burn my self. Even though I’m not a fan of frying, I still love the crispy crunch they have. With that being said I present to you my delicious vegan katsu curry with baked tofu. Above all the tofu has that crispy crunch without the hassle of frying. While my little sister was in town I made this for her and she enjoyed it and she’s not even a vegan or a vegetarian. This curry is packed full of flavor and pairs perfectly with the baked tofu katsu. So if your craving some katsu curry give this recipe a try.
